B&M Care Head Office is looking for an Operations Manager to primarily be responsible for the continuous financial growth of the company and the successful operation of the Company's care homes.
Responsibilities:
- Supporting home managers to maximise occupancy, maximise profits and control costs to budgets.
- Working and supporting the Director of Governance with robust monitoring of homes audits, PCS, Radar and inspections.
- Assisting where required with supporting and optimising the successful operation of all the Company's Care Homes.
- Managing a care home during a manager's period of absence.
- Being supportive in new care homes as required, working alongside the Home Manager to optimise the successful operation.
- Ensuring that all homes are working in line with the Company's quality management system.
- Being involved as required in heading up the Company's Management Pathways scheme and functioning in an educational/training and development role for the success of future B&M Care home Managers.
- Assisting Managers in resolving problem situations in their homes.
- Assisting in the induction and development of senior members of a home's management team.
- Communicating effectively with Managers to achieve the objectives of the business by providing support and guidance.
- Supporting Managers to be inspiring leaders.
- Travelling to any of the Company's homes as required.
Skills, Characteristics and Experience:
- NVQ Level 5 or Registered Manager Award (RMA) or equivalent.
- Understanding the BCC model, within the organisation.
